College, high school students join sex workers in Eldoret

Jul. 24, 2013, 12:00 am
Some of the prostitutes at Mtwapa Kilifi County, several cases have been reported over increase in prostitution at the Coast region .Photo Elkana JacobSome of the prostitutes at Mtwapa Kilifi County, several cases have been reported over increase in prostitution at the Coast region .Photo Elkana Jacob

COMMERCIAL sex workers in Eldoret have raised concern over an influx of university students into their business.

They said business is bad because of the students' encroachment.

One of the twilight girl who spoke to the Star at a common joint on Uganda Road said the intruders offer their services at throwaway prices.

"These young educated ladies are hurting our businesses. They will run us out of the market," she said.

The women said some of the students, including high school girls, have abandoned their studies because of the lucrative business. 

Eldoret serves as a transit town to Uganda. 

The most targeted group of customers are maize and wheat farmers who are swindled of millions of shillings.

Uasin Gishu Governor Jackson Mandago has passed a legislative that will help tame the businesses. 

"We will do all we can to ensure that we deal with this menace once and for all. We have to rebrand our town even some of the names of the buildings where the dirty business is conducted," he said.

Most of the dwellers of the towns have complained that they are embarrassed by the women when crossing the streets.

"I was embarrassed one day when I was taking a stroll with my family when one of this ladies shouted whether she could offer me her services," said Jackson Koech, a resident.
